Europe Antimicrobial Coating for Medical Devices Market Segmentation and Market Companies

Segments

- Product Type: The Europe antimicrobial coating for medical devices market can be segmented based on product type into metallic coatings, non-metallic coatings, and others. Metallic coatings are expected to dominate the market due to their durability and effectiveness in preventing microbial growth on medical devices. Non-metallic coatings are also gaining traction in the market due to their versatility and compatibility with different types of medical devices.
- Material Type: The market can be segmented by material type into silver coatings, copper coatings, titanium coatings, and others. Silver coatings are projected to hold a significant market share as silver is known for its strong antimicrobial properties. Copper coatings are also anticipated to witness growth, thanks to the increasing awareness of copper's antimicrobial benefits.
- Device Type: Based on device type, the market can be segmented into catheters, implants, surgical instruments, gloves, and others. Catheters are likely to account for a substantial market share due to the high prevalence of catheter-associated infections. Implants are also expected to contribute significantly to the market growth as antimicrobial coatings help in reducing the risk of implant-related infections.
